now days these chips are pushed to their limits too
these are my numbers on my main rigs and kinda reasonable with many others
q6600 mod with water or great cooling gave 50% overclock ez
my 2600k gave me 25% overclock
my 4770k gave like 15% overclock
8700k gave like 10% if that
10860k and many others recently i gave up 1600x. 5600x was fun to tinker with but gave up they werent getting much either
i did have had many 550be unlocked to quads back in the day too
